**First-day checklist — Item 6: Spare hardware store**

Show the new starter Room B-14, the storage room for spare laptops, monitors, and cables at Quellmark's east corridor. Explain that all withdrawals go in the green logbook on the shelf. The door stays locked at all times; it opens with the standard staff door-pass code listed below.

turnstile pass: bdg-PD-2

Audit item 7 — cold starts. Check that every serverless handler in the Foglamp stack keeps its init block lean: no database pools, no schema fetches, nothing heavier than config parsing before the first request. We keep a warm-pool of two instances per region, but don't lean on it — it's a crutch, not a fix. If a handler's p99 cold start creeps past 800ms, flag it in the checklist and ping the owner named below.

named custodian: Brivan Eliath Quenox Frador

MEMO — Sales Leads Only

Re: Joint venture with Tornquist Marine

We intend to sign a JV covering the Ostermere coastal market. Tornquist brings distribution; we bring the Seaglass product line. Target signature: end of quarter.

Until then: no joint pitches, no co-branded materials, no mention of Tornquist to prospects. Active deals in Ostermere pause at proposal stage — flag them to Dale Renner.

Comp plans for the JV territory will be issued at launch.

Read the confidential note appended below before your Monday pipeline calls.

board note of bawep-tajef: Queniusek Systems plans to raise the Quenvan list price by 53.1 percent in March. The pricing group signed off on a budget of $176.4 million for Project Drueth. The renewal with Casionix Partners closes at $142.5 million a year, 8.3 percent below the last contract. Project Fraax slips by six weeks because of the tooling delay.

Capacity note for the weekly sync: the GiftLedger donation-receipt mailer will see its annual peak during the Harvest Drive, roughly 40x baseline volume. Render workers on the Pinebrook cluster currently cap at 1,200 receipts per minute; we plan to scale the pool horizontally and raise the SMTP relay concurrency. Queue depth alarms stay as-is. Batch size, retry backoff, and worker counts were re-derived from last quarter's load replay. The constants we intend to ship are below.

tuning constants:
BUDGETS = {
    "druath": 240,
    "lamwyn": 180,
    "silael": 275,
}